Crypto Hacks Hit $52 Million in March as ‘Shadow Contagion’ Risk Spreads Across DeFi Ecosystem

Share this post:

The decentralized finance sector recorded a sharp rise in security breaches during March, with total losses reaching approximately $52 million across multiple incidents. According to data shared by PeckShield, crypto related hacks surged nearly 96 percent compared to the previous month, highlighting growing vulnerabilities across the ecosystem. While the headline figure reflects direct financial losses, analysts warn that the broader impact extends far beyond individual attacks, raising concerns about systemic risks that could affect interconnected platforms and liquidity networks.

The data indicates that around 20 separate incidents contributed to the total losses, marking a significant increase from February levels. A large portion of these breaches were linked to wallet compromises and phishing attacks, which together accounted for more than 80 percent of the total damage. These attack vectors continue to exploit user level vulnerabilities rather than core protocol flaws, suggesting that security challenges are increasingly shifting toward access management and social engineering rather than purely technical exploits within smart contracts.

Beyond immediate losses, researchers have highlighted a deeper structural issue described as shadow contagion, where the effects of a single exploit extend across multiple protocols. In highly interconnected DeFi systems, assets are often reused across lending platforms, liquidity pools, and derivatives markets. When one component is compromised, it can trigger a cascade of effects including bad debt accumulation, liquidity shortages, and forced liquidations. This interconnected risk model means that even platforms not directly attacked can experience financial stress due to dependencies within the ecosystem.

The concept of shadow contagion reflects the evolving complexity of decentralized finance, where composability is both a strength and a vulnerability. While interconnected protocols enable efficiency and innovation, they also create pathways for risk transmission that are difficult to contain. Analysts note that as DeFi grows in scale, these indirect effects could become more pronounced, especially during periods of market volatility when liquidity conditions are already under pressure. The trend underscores the importance of stronger risk management frameworks and real time monitoring across platforms.

Market participants are increasingly focusing on improving security practices and infrastructure resilience to mitigate these risks. Efforts include enhanced wallet protections, stricter access controls, and better auditing of smart contracts. However, the persistence of phishing and social engineering attacks suggests that user awareness remains a critical factor. As the ecosystem continues to expand, addressing both technical and behavioral vulnerabilities will be essential to maintaining stability and confidence in decentralized financial systems.
